Running "perf list" on powerpc fails with segfault as below: ./perf list Segmentation fault (core dumped)
This happens because of duplicate events in the json list. The powerpc Json event list contains some event with same event name, but different event code. They are: - PM_INST_FROM_L3MISS (Present in datasource and frontend) - PM_MRK_DATA_FROM_L2MISS (Present in datasource and marked) - PM_MRK_INST_FROM_L3MISS (Present in datasource and marked) - PM_MRK_DATA_FROM_L3MISS (Present in datasource and marked) pmu_events_table__num_events uses the value from table_pmu->num_entries which includes duplicate events as well. This causes issue during "perf list" and results in segmentation fault. Since both event codes are valid, append _DSRC to the Data Source events (datasource.json), so that they would have a unique name. Also add PM_DATA_FROM_L2MISS_DSRC and PM_DATA_FROM_L3MISS_DSRC events. With the fix, perf list works as expected.
